Question 418517: Two men working together can do a job in 20 days. After both have been working 10 days, one quits. The other man finishes the job in 12 more days. How many days would each man have needed to do the job alone?

the job is half done (10/20) when the 1st man quits

the 2nd man does the second half in 12 days , so it would take him 24 days to do the job alone

in the 10 days they worked together , the 2nd man did 10/24 ,(5/12), of the job
___ since together they did 1/2 ,(6/12), ; this means that the 1st man did 1/12 ,(6/12 - 5/12), in 10 days
___ it would take the 1st man 120 days ,(10 / 1/12), to do the job alone
